dc.description.abstractAn enzyme-linked immunosorbent assay (EWA ) was adapted for the detection of maize rayado lino vims (REV) in its insect vector Dalbulus midis. Optimization of experimental conditions for the assay included the use of anti-REV immunoglobulin G (IgG) purified by ion exchange chromatography and the determination of critical concentrations of the enzyme-IgG conjugate, Tween 20 and bovine serum albumen. Under the experimental conditions described in this work, it was possible to detect viral antigens in individual leafhoppers at concentrations of less than 1.0 ng.es_ES
